City Council Moves Meetings to Tuesday
The City Council will begin meeting on Tuesdays starting next week, a move designed to give council members more time to prepare.
With Monday meetings, council members said they sometimes lacked enough time to question staff members about issues on the agendas.
The council adopted a resolution at its last meeting, changing the regular meeting to the second and fourth Tuesdays of the month.
Meetings start at 5 p.m. in City Council chambers, 6650 Beach Blvd.
